IGBT gate drive phot coupler 'ACPL-302J-000E'

Full-featured phot coupler! Available in a compact surface-mount SO-16 package.

The ACPL-302J-000E is an IGBT gate driver optocoupler with a built-in isolated flyback DC-DC converter controller, providing a 2.5A output. With its high-speed transmission delay performance, it achieves excellent timing control and efficiency. It is ideal for driving IGBTs and power MOSFETs in applications such as industrial inverters, motor drives, power equipment, and renewable energy generation. 【Features】 ■ Stabilized output voltage: 20V ■ Wide input voltage range: 8–18V ■ Maximum peak output current: ±2.5A ■ Rail-to-rail output voltage ■ Mirror clamp sink current: 1.7A * You can download the English version of the catalog. * For more details, please refer to the PDF document or feel free to contact us.

Gate drive photocoupler "ACPL-K34T-000E"

Short transmission delay and small timing skew! A design suitable for driving MOSFETs.

The "ACPL-K34T-000E" is an automotive R²Coupler MOSFET gate drive photocoupler with a peak output of 2.5A. It features short transmission delay and small timing skew, making it suitable for driving power MOSFETs used in AC-DC and DC-DC converters. With a wide operating voltage range for the output stage, it can accommodate various gate control devices. 【Features】 ■ AEC-Q100 Grade 1 test guideline certified ■ Operating temperature range: -40°C to +125°C ■ Maximum peak output current: 2.5A ■ Transmission delay: 110ns (maximum) ■ Dead time range: -40ns to +50ns * An English version of the catalog is available for download. * For more details, please refer to the PDF materials or feel free to contact us.

Gate drive photocoupler "ACNU-3430-000E"

Three times the speed of the previous generation! It prevents gate driver malfunctions in noisy environments.

The 『ACNU-3430-000E』 is a 5A output gate drive photocoupler in an 11mm surface-mount SSO-8 package, designed for industrial applications with high voltage and space constraints, such as 600VAC motor drives and 1kVDC solar inverters. The compact package with an 11mm creepage distance and a 10.5mm clearance distance provides excellent high voltage protection and signal isolation in tight spaces. 【Features】 ■ Maximum peak output current: 5A ■ Rail-to-rail output voltage ■ UVLO based on VE ■ Maximum propagation delay: 150ns ■ Maximum propagation delay difference: 90ns * You can download the English version of the catalog. * For more details, please refer to the PDF materials or feel free to contact us.

Gate drive photocoupler "ACNT-H313-000E"

The output stage operates over a wide voltage range! It provides the drive voltage necessary for gate control devices.

The "ACNT-H313-000E" is a high-performance 2.5A gate driver optocoupler with a creepage distance and clearance of 14.2mm. The voltage output and high peak current of the optocoupler allow for direct driving of IGBTs. It adopts a stretch SO8 package with a creepage distance and clearance of 14.2mm, providing the long creepage and clearance required for high voltage power supply applications, as well as a high reinforced insulation voltage. 【Features】 ■ Maximum peak output current: 2.5A ■ Minimum peak output current: 2.0A ■ Maximum propagation delay: 500ns ■ Maximum propagation delay difference: 350ns ■ Minimum common mode rejection (CMR) performance: 40kV/μs @ VCM = 20,000V * You can download the English version of the catalog. * For more details, please refer to the PDF document or feel free to contact us.

Gate drive optocoupler "ACPL-W349-000E"

It is possible to directly drive MOSFETs and IGBTs with a maximum rating of 1200V/100A.

The 『ACPL-W349-000E』 is a high-speed gate drive photocoupler device with a built-in AlGaAs LED and a power output stage that couples optically to integrated circuits. This device is used in power conversion applications. The wide operating voltage range of the power stage provides the necessary drive voltage for gate control elements. 【Features】 ■ Maximum peak output current: 2.5A ■ Wide operating voltage Vcc range: 15–30V ■ Maximum propagation delay: 110ns ■ Maximum propagation delay difference: 50ns ■ Rail-to-rail output voltage *You can download the English version of the catalog. *For more details, please refer to the PDF materials or feel free to contact us.

Output gate drive photocoupler "ACPL-337J-000E"

Provides safe signal separation and high insulation reliability in high-pressure, noisy industrial applications.

The ACPL-337J-000E is a fully functional 4.0A output gate drive photocoupler that can directly drive IGBTs and power MOSFETs. It is equipped with a high DESAT brake current source and feedback function with undervoltage lockout (UVLO). It allows for easy play in motor control and power inverter/converter applications. 【Features】 ■ Maximum peak output current: 4.0A ■ Rail-to-rail output voltage ■ Mirror clamp sink current: 2.0A ■ Built-in protection function for FETs/IGBTs ■ Maximum propagation delay (across the entire temperature range): 250ns * You can download the English version of the catalog. * For more details, please refer to the PDF materials or feel free to contact us.

Gate drive optocoupler "ACNW3430"

Ideal for driving IGBTs and power MOSFETs used in motor control inverters!

The ACNW3430 is a gate drive optocoupler that incorporates an LED optically coupled to an integrated circuit with a power output stage. It features noise immunity of 100kV/μs, preventing false triggering in noisy industrial environments. With its output voltage and high peak output current, it is ideal for direct driving of IGBTs. Additionally, it has a maximum operating isolation voltage of VIORM=1414 Vpeak according to IEC/EN/DIN EN 60747-5-5. **Features** - Peak output current of 5.0A (maximum) - Rail-to-rail output voltage - UVLO based on VE when using a negative power supply - Maximum propagation delay time of 150ns - Maximum propagation delay time difference of 90ns *For more details, please refer to the PDF document or feel free to contact us.*

Gate drive photocoupler "ACPL-32JT"

High noise resistance! Provides high insulation and reliability suitable for automotive and high-temperature industrial applications.

The "ACPL-32JT" is a 2.5A peak IGBT gate drive photocoupler for R2Coupler automotive applications. It incorporates an isolated flyback DC-DC controller, non-saturation detection function, active mirror clamp function, and UVLO feedback function. With a short propagation delay time and high precision timing skew performance, it achieves excellent timing control and efficiency. 【Features】 ■ Compliant with AEC-Q100 Grade 1 test guidelines ■ Operating temperature range suitable for automotive applications: -40°C to 125°C ■ Isolated flyback DC-DC controller ■ Stabilized output voltage: 20V ■ Peak output current: 2.5A (maximum) *For more details, please refer to the PDF document or feel free to contact us.

IGBT/SiC/GaN Gate Drive Photocoupler ACFL-3161

Output peak current 10A. Achieves high-speed switching in noisy environments. *Reference design diagram included in the explanatory materials.

The ACFL-3161 is a gate drive photocoupler with a peak output current of 10A. It excels in industrial applications where high insulation performance is required, such as motors and inverters, and where there are constraints on mounting space. It features a common mode transient immunity (CMTI) of over 100kV/μs, preventing malfunctions in gate driving in noisy environments. Additionally, with a propagation delay of less than 95ns, it enables high-speed switching, contributing to improved driving efficiency of IGBTs and SiC/GaN MOSFETs. **Features** - Single-channel SO-12 package, with creepage and clearance distances of approximately 8mm - Material class I, supporting CTI ≧ 600V - Achievable rise and fall times of 7ns (typ) - Numerous applications in buses and railway vehicles *Evaluation boards are available. Gate drive photocoupler "ACPL-355JC"

Output peak current 10A. For driving IGBT/SiC/GaN modules. SO16 package with protection function, CTI 600V (material class I).

The "ACPL-355JC" is a gate drive photocoupler that supports a peak output current of 10A and a wide operating voltage. With its high common-mode noise rejection capability (100kV/μs), it is suitable for driving modules such as IGBTs and SiC/GaN MOSFETs in motor control and inverter applications. It features excellent timing skew performance, with a propagation delay time of 140ns. It is equipped with functional safety to protect the module from overcurrent and report the status to the controller. 【Features】 ■ Compact implementation in an SO16 package with protection function CTI600V (material class I) ■ Reinforced insulation certified by international safety standards IEC/EN/DIN, UL, and CSA * A release of the automotive product "ACFL-3161T" compliant with AEC-Q100 Grade 1 is also planned. * Evaluation boards for SiC-MOSFETs (for Infineon and Wolfseed) are available. Gate drive photocoupler "ACPL-352J"

High-speed transmission delay and excellent timing skew performance!

The ACPL-352J is a 5A output intelligent gate driver optocoupler. With a high peak output current and a wide operating voltage range, it is ideal for directly driving SiC/GaN MOSFETs and IGBTs in motor control and inverter applications. It provides reinforced insulation certified by safety standards IEC/EN/DIN, UL, and CSA. 【Features】 ■ Maximum peak output current: 5.0A ■ Minimum peak output current: 4.5A ■ Maximum propagation delay time: 150ns ■ Dual output to control turn-on and turn-off times ■ Short-circuit (non-saturation) detection and adjustable soft shutdown function *For more details, please refer to the PDF document or feel free to contact us.
